Tom Stoppard is widely regarded as one of the leading contemporary British playwrights; a writer who has earned an intriguing mix of both critical and commercial success. Arcadia is considered by many critics to be Stoppards masterpiece; a work that weds his love for words and ideas in his early career; with his emphasis on storytelling and emotional engagement in his later career. With its engaging alteration between past and present Arcadia offers a comedic and entertaining exploration of chaos theory; entropy; the Second Law of thermodynamics; iterated algorithms; fractals; and other concepts culled from the realms of math and science.

Book for KnittersBy Lynne E.This is a "Believe It or Not!" book for knitters; and its a lot of fun. Basically; its a book about oddball knitting projects; with each project described in a few paragraphs and illustrated with photos. Many projects will be familiar to long-time knitting enthusiasts; such as Debbie News knitted teacups; Althea Cromes miniature masterpiece sweaters; Jan Messents knitted gardens; and Lauren Porters full-size knitted Ferrari. Others may be less familiar; such as Gelatins giant rabbit (viewable from space); Jimini Hignetts knitted body parts; Gayle Roehms knitted Faberge egg; Inga Hamiltons crocheted reefs; and Merel Karhofs scarves knitted by windmills.The book illustrates the incredible creativity of artists who knit; as well as the amazing range of possibilities that exist for creating knitted objects and garments. There are only a few patterns; although these include instructions for a penguin sweater (used in zoos); and an "origami" crane for peace. This is a must-have book for any serious knitter/artist; as a source of inspiration and of information on whats already been done.
